Nepali Worker Crushed to Death by Forklift at Ready-Mix Concrete Plant
[Asia Economy Yeongnam Reporting Headquarters, Reporter Ju Cheol-in] A foreign worker employed at a ready-mixed concrete factory died after being crushed by a forklift.
According to Hapcheon Police Station on the 29th, A (35), a Nepalese national working at a ready-mixed concrete factory in Hapcheon, was crushed and killed by a forklift at 9:56 a.m. on the 26th.
At the time of the accident, B, who was operating the forklift, failed to notice A, who was sorting nearby, causing the accident, according to the investigation.

The police have booked B, the forklift operator, on charges of involuntary manslaughter due to negligence and are investigating the exact cause of the accident.
